Basement seepage repair services focus on identifying and fixing water intrusion issues that originate from the ground outside a property.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ation, walls, and flooring to determine the source of moisture or water leaks. Once the problem areas are identified, contractors may install or upgrade waterproofing systems, such as sealants, membranes, or drainage solutions, to prevent water from seeping through. Proper sealing and drainage help protect the basement from ongoing moisture problems, reducing the risk of damage and mold growth.
Seepage issues often lead to a range of problems for homeowners, including dampness, musty odors, peeling paint, and even structural deterioration over time. Water that infiltrates basements can cause wood rot, weaken foundation walls, and promote mold and mildew development, which can impact indoor air quality. Addressing basement seepage early can prevent these costly damages and create a more stable, dry environment inside the home. Service providers use specialized tools and techniques to diagnose the cause of water entry and recommend effective solutions tailored to each property’s needs.
Properties that typically benefit from basement seepage repair include older homes with less advanced waterproofing, homes built on poorly draining soil, or those with existing cracks or foundation issues. Both residential and commercial buildings with underground levels or basements are vulnerable to seepage problems. In areas with heavy rainfall or fluctuating groundwater levels, the risk of water intrusion increases, making professional repair services essential. The overview below groups typical Basement Seepage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Reedsburg,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typically, local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for common seepage fixes such as minor cracks or small patch jobs.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the seepage and materials needed.
Moderate Seepage Solutions - Projects involving more extensive sealing or waterproofing usually cost between $600 and $2,000. These jobs often include additional surface preparations and may require some minor excavation or surface treatment.
Major Repairs or Waterproofing - Larger, more complex projects such as full basement waterproofing or foundation sealing can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ving significant structural work or extensive surface area coverage.
Full Basement Replacement - Complete basement waterproofing or foundation replacement can exceed $5,000, with costs depending heavily on the size and condition of the space. Such projects are less common and usually involve comprehensive work to ensure long-term protection.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es basement seepage? Basement seepage can result from poor drainage, foundation cracks, or high groundwater levels that allow water to penetrate through walls or floors.
How can local contractors fix basement seepage? They typically assess the source of water entry, then implement solutions such as sealing cracks, improving drainage systems, or installing waterproof barriers.
Are waterproofing methods permanent? Many waterproofing techniques are designed to provide long-term protection, but the effectiveness depends on proper installation and ongoing maintenance.
What are common signs of basement seepage? Signs include damp or moldy walls, water stains, musty odors, or visible water pooling after heavy rain.
